As part of the TOS Crew I received for review Jean Welles Worship Guitar Class volume-1. This is a DVD course with book and designed for ages 10-adult. The core training is on the DVD with the teacher taking you through the beginning steps of how to play guitar.
Jean Welles has a masters degree in guitar performance and is a worship leader in her church. She shares her story and how she is inspired to share Christ and worship through her music. The first lessons explain the parts of a guitar and how to tune it corectly, then the next lessons are on different chord progressions with a song to be learned with each lesson. Songs taught are: My All and All, More Precious Than Silver, Lord, I Lift Your name On High, and more.
There are also practice sessions for each song, these give more tips for playing the song and are slowed down for the beginning leaner.
By the end of these lessons your student will have learned to play 7 worship songs, 10 chords and 6 strumming and finger patterns.

What are EXPLORE and PLAN?  They are tests based on the ACT, but designed for 8-9th graders, EXPLORE, or 10th graders, PLAN. These tests are shorter than the ACT, but will give you information to see how your child is doing in four areas: Math, English,
Reading and Science. There is help in the back of the book for scoring and understanding the test results. These tests were designed to help you get an early indication of how your child will do on the ACT.

Maestro Classics  is the publisher of a series of CDs that put orchestral music together with classic stories. This award-winning classical music series for children and families from Maestro Classics has done an outstanding job of combining music appretiation with great stories.

I received a CD: The Tortoise and the Hare to review as part of the TOS Crew. The CD contains several tracks,  the story with music, information on the story, Aesop, and fables and a discussion of the moral, an explanation as to how the music was chosen to fit the story, and a sing a long song.. There is also colorful activity booklet that comes with the CD with great information on instruments, the orchestra, notes and time signatures,crossword puzzles and more.

Mathletics is a web based math service that allows children to work through age specific lessons that include step by step animated teaching, and live challenges, were the children compete with other children from all over the world. The student accumalates points as they go through the lessons, play games and do live challenges. With the earned points the students get to go shopping for clothing and backgrounds for their character, which they create at the begining set up.
Mathletics also has games that the students unlock as they progress through the lessons, and additional games are available through access to Rainforest Math.


At the Parent Center, parents can view each childs progress, print workbooks at each level and even set it up so that your child must complete certain activities BEFORE having access to everything!

So what is TEKTOMA?
TEKTOMA is a website that offers video tutorials to teach game programming. These tutorials require a free version of gameMaker software from YoYo Games, that you download for free. Children ages 7-17, (and even us adults), can learn to create computer games using these very friendly and easy to understand video tutorials.
The tutorials will teach varying skill levels from beginner to those with more experience.
The complete game tutorials include:
Racing game
Arcade game
Memory game
Platform game
Fantasy game
